Begin a spiritual journey with the sacred Do Dham Yatra (Badrinath Kedarnath yatra), covering the revered shrines of badrinath kedarnath. Nestled in the majestic Himalayas, these holy destinations hold profound significance for devotees seeking spiritual solace.

Kedarnath Yatra

As you embark on this pilgrimage, Kedarnath welcomes you with its serene ambiance. The ancient Kedarnath Temple, a dedication to Lord Shiva, stands as a testament to unwavering faith. The trek to Kedarnath provides breathtaking views of snow-clad peaks, creating a soul-stirring experience. Pilgrims find solace in rhythmic chants and the divine aura surrounding the temple.

Transitioning to Badrinath, the journey unfolds amidst picturesque landscapes and tranquil surroundings. The Badrinath Temple, dedicated to Lord Vishnu, is a marvel of architecture and spirituality. Devotees find respite in the blissful atmosphere, where the confluence of Alaknanda and Saraswati rivers adds to the sanctity.

Badrinath Yatra

Badrinath, the final destination, beckons with its spiritual energy. Pilgrims witness the iconic idol of Lord Badrinath, surrounded by the panoramic beauty of the Neelkanth Peak. The Tapt Kund, a natural hot spring, offers a rejuvenating experience before entering the temple.

Throughout the Do Dham Yatra, tranquil landscapes and sacred rituals create an aura of divine connection. The yatra, harmonizing spirituality with natural beauty, becomes a transformative experience for seekers.

Guptakashi : The name Gupt Kashi means Hidden Benares. Mythology describes how when the Pandava brothers were searching for a glimpse of Shiva, Shivji first concealed himself at Guptkashi, but later fled from them further up the valley to Kedarnath, where the Pandavas finally got their wish fulfilled. There are more tangible connections as well-the Kedarnath pandas (priests) live in Guptkashi during the winter months, and after the Kedarnath temple closes for the winter, the image of Kedarnath passes through Gupt Kashi on its way to Ukhimath (across the valley), where it stays for the winter.

Positioning right amidst a wide flat terrain, Kedarnath is a imposing sight that is enclosed with tall snow covered mountains. Built by Adi Shankaracharya in the 8th century, the Kedarnath temple is located nearby to the site of an earlier temple which was constructed by the Pandavas. The temple is dedicated to Lord Shiva. One can witness the big statue of the Nandi Bull standing outside the temple as guard. It is a major highlight of the temple. Also, another major of the temple is its interior that portray scenes from mythology and figures of various deities.

Badrinath, a holy town located in Chamoli district in Uttarakhand state in India is famous for people visiting across the nation to get blessed from god and goddesses. It is very often known as Char Dham pilgrimage of Hindu devotees and is attended by millions of people across the globe.The name of the city ahs been named after the very famous and renowned globally temple Badrinath.

Tapt Kund : This kund is very famously known as the natural thermal springs situated on the banks of river Alaknanda. It is mandatory for everyone to bathe here before even entering the Badrinath temple.

Narad Kund : It is a recess in the river, near the Tapt Kund which forms as a pool from where ideally the Badrinath idol was recovered.

Mata Murty Temple : This well known temple is devoted to the mother of Sri Badrinathji. There are various globally acclaimed and famous temples which are Sesh Netra Temple, Urvashi Temple and Charanpaduka.

Mana Village : This temple is inhabitted by an Indo-Mongolian tribe. This tribe is also known as the last Indian village before Tibet.

Bhim Pul : On one side of the very famous Mana village lies a massive rock forming a natural bridge which further lies over the roaring Saraswati River. It gives away a spectacular and mesmerizing view of water thundering down through the narrow passage under the rock. It is believed among the peiple that it was placed by Bhim who was the second eldest among the five Pandava brothers.

Vyas Gufa (Cave) : Again near the very famous Mana Village, this is a rock-cave and here the Ved Vyas is believed to have written and composed the Mahabharata and other pauranic commentaries.

Rishikesh : This place is located at 24 Kms. from Hardwar and is further on the laps of the lower Himalayas. The entire locality is surrounded by scenic beauty of the hills followed by greenery all around and on its three sides flowing Holy Ganga. The entire place is said to be sacred as it is the meditation point for many to further attain salvation. You can find various temples and schools here and some are also located along the river Ganges. Not only Rishikesh is known only as a pilgrimage centre but is also closely associated with the Ramayana and is also an important center of Hindu religious thought and spirituality. Not only this, the city is known for housing various renowned Yoga Centres, ashrams and Yoga institutes here. last not but the least, Rishikesh is also the entry point to various important religious places like Badrinath, Kedarnath, Gangotri, and Yamunotri.
